What is Fentanyl?

Fentanyl is an effective artificial opioid that is structured similarly to morphine however is substantially more powerful. In a clinical setting, it is prescribed for the management of severe pain, usually for post-surgical healing or advanced-stage cancer. Nevertheless, due to its high effectiveness, it has actually ended up being a main driver of overdose deaths internationally.

To comprehend the scale of its intensity, it is helpful to compare it to other known compounds.

Table 1: Potency Comparison of Common Opioids

CompoundRelative Potency to MorphineMedical Use Cases
Morphine1xStandard for moderate to severe discomfort
Heroin2x - 5xNo acknowledged medical use in the majority of contexts (UK)
Fentanyl50x - 100xSerious chronic discomfort, anesthesia
Carfentanil10,000 xVeterinary tranquilizer (for big animals)

In the UK, fentanyl is strictly controlled under the Misuse of Drugs Act 1971. It is classified as a Class An illegal drug. This puts it in the same legal classification as heroin and cocaine, reflecting the high capacity for harm and addiction.

The ownership, production, and circulation of fentanyl without a legitimate medical prescription and license are serious criminal offenses.

  • Belongings: Being found in ownership of fentanyl without a prescription can lead to as much as 7 years in jail, an endless fine, or both.
  • Supply and Production: Those captured selling or distributing the substance (including mailing it through online orders) can confront life imprisonment.

The Home Office and the National Crime Agency (NCA) actively monitor digital markets. Contrary to popular belief, utilizing Bitcoin does not grant total resistance from the law, as blockchain forensics allow authorities to track transactions to exchange points where identities are typically verified.

The Myth of Anonymity

While Bitcoin supplies a layer of separation from traditional banking, it is not undetectable. The general public journal (Blockchain) records every transaction. Law enforcement agencies now utilize advanced software to "deanonymize" users by connecting digital wallets to IP addresses or "Know Your Customer" (KYC) documents at major exchanges.

The Dangers of Procurement via the Dark Web

Trying to buy fentanyl online through Bitcoin-funded marketplaces brings extreme threats that extend beyond legal prosecution.

1. Lack of Quality Control

Illegally made fentanyl (IMF) is frequently produced in private labs with no regulatory oversight. This results in several issues:

  • Hot Spots: A single tablet might include a deadly dosage while another includes none, due to poor blending.
  • Contamination: Products are often cut with other unsafe substances like xylazine (a veterinary sedative) which does not react to Narcan/Naloxone.

The Lethality of Fentanyl

Fentanyl is so powerful that a dose as small as 2 milligrams-- approximately the size of a few grains of salt-- can be fatal to a typical grownup. This tiny margin for error is why the illegal market is so deadly.

Indications of an Opioid Overdose

Comprehending the indications of an overdose is important for public security. If these signs happen, emergency situation services ought to be gotten in touch with instantly.

  • Pinpoint pupils.
  • Slow, shallow, or stopped breathing.
  • Loss of consciousness or extreme sleepiness.
  • Limp body.
  • Cold and/or clammy skin.
  • Blue or purple fingernails and lips (cyanosis).

Why the UK is Cracking Down

The National Crime Agency (NCA) has reported a significant boost in the existence of artificial opioids in the UK heroin supply. This "contamination" is a public health crisis. Since fentanyl is less expensive to produce and simpler to smuggle in little quantities, it is often utilized by dealers to increase the potency of their stock, resulting in unintentional deaths among users who are uninformed they are consuming fentanyl.
